#18faf4 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#18faf4 is composed of 9.4% red, 98% green and 95.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 90.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 2.4% yellow and 2% black. It has a hue angle of 178.4 degrees, a saturation of 95.8% and a lightness of 53.7%. #18faf4 color hex could be obtained by blending #30ffff with #00f5e9. Closest websafe color is: #00ffff.

#18faf4 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#18faf4 has RGB values of R:24, G:250, B:244 and CMYK values of C:0.9, M:0, Y:0.02, K:0.02. Its decimal value is 1637108.
